Many Cleveland OH eye doctors & optometrists list major insurance plans including Blue Cross Blue Shield, Aetna, UnitedHealthcare, Cigna, Humana, and Medicare. Listings reflect what providers have indicated they accept — always confirm in-network status directly with the office before booking. Out-of-network visits can cost 3–5× more than in-network ones.
In-network eye doctors & optometrists in Cleveland OH typically run $120–$300 for an initial visit before insurance. Out-of-network rates can be 3–5× higher. Most PPO plans in allow direct booking. HMO and many Medicare Advantage plans require a primary-care referral first. Confirm with your insurer or the office before booking.
